Title :
Optimal target location in multichannel images

Abstract :
We propose algorithms for the location of a known target in a multichannel image, optimal for the multichannel model of the image, and optimal for the noise model of the image. We consider two noise models: Gaussian additive, and Gaussian non-overlapping. We show on simulations the improvement due to the multichannel model of the image, compared with the monochannel case. For simulations, the multichannel images are color images
